Swiss Dental Implants
What is a Dental Implant A dental implant, sometimes called a tooth implant, is an artificial tooth root (synthetic material) that is surgically anchored into your jaw to hold a replacement tooth or bridge in place. All of our offices are also equipped with digital radiography. Digital radiography provides a tool that eases diagnosis and treatment planning. As well as so many options enhancing and changing the radiography for identification. With digital x-rays a dentist is able to magnify, sharpen, or darken an x-ray.
